merge: apply non-interactive working dir updates in parallel

This has a big effect on the performance of working dir updates.

Here are the results of update from null to the given rev in several
repos, on a Linux 3.2 system with 32 cores running ext4, with the progress
extension enabled.

repo             rev           plain  parallel   speedup
hg               7068089c95a2    0.9       0.3       3
mozilla-central  fe1600b22c77   42.8       7.7       5.5
linux-2.6        9ef4b770e069   31.4       4.9       6.4
